THE ruling Cambodian People’s Party is set to host the 6th General Assembly of the International Conference of Asian Political Parties, which will kick off in Phnom Penh on December 1. Ek Tha, the local spokesman of ICAPP, said the four-day event would demonstrate Cambodia’s “key role” in promoting regional economic cooperation. The prime ministers of Sri Lanka, Malaysia and Nepal, as well as representatives of 90 Asian political parties from 37 countries, are expected to attend the conference, according to a statement issued by ICAPP on Sunday.
